Method

Marinade & Chicken

1

Make the marinade

In a medium bowl whisk together soy sauce, gochujang, honey, rice vinegar, sesame oil, minced garlic, grated ginger, kosher salt and black pepper until smooth and well combined.

2

Marinate the chicken

Trim any excess fat from the chicken thighs and cut into 1-inch strips. Add chicken to the bowl with the marinade, toss to coat thoroughly. Cover and refrigerate for at least 20 minutes and up to 2 hours. If short on time, you can proceed after 10–15 minutes.

3

Cook the chicken

Heat 1 tablespoon vegetable oil in a large nonstick skillet or cast-iron pan over medium-high heat until shimmering. Remove chicken from marinade (reserve marinade) and add pieces in a single layer (work in batches if needed). Sear without moving for 2 minutes to develop color, then stir and continue cooking 3–4 more minutes until chicken is cooked through (internal temperature 165°F/74°C) and edges are caramelized. Transfer cooked chicken to a plate and tent with foil.

Vegetables & Stir-Fry

4

Prepare vegetables

While chicken marinates or cooks, cut broccoli into bite-size florets, slice bell pepper, julienne the carrot, slice zucchini and separate white and green parts of green onions. Mince/slice the extra garlic clove.

5

Stir-fry vegetables

In the same skillet used for chicken (add another 1 tablespoon oil if needed), heat over medium-high. Add white parts of green onions and sliced garlic, stirring 20–30 seconds until fragrant. Add broccoli and carrots and stir-fry 2–3 minutes. Add bell pepper and zucchini and continue to stir-fry 2–3 minutes until vegetables are bright and just tender-crisp. Season lightly with kosher salt and optional red pepper flakes.

Sauce & Finish

6

Make a quick sauce

Whisk the reserved marinade with 1/4 cup broth and 1 teaspoon cornstarch in a small bowl until smooth. Pour the mixture into the skillet with vegetables and bring to a gentle simmer, stirring, until sauce thickens and becomes glossy, about 1–2 minutes.

7

Combine chicken and vegetables

Return the cooked chicken and any accumulated juices to the skillet. Toss everything together so the sauce evenly coats the chicken and vegetables. Cook another 1 minute to heat through and meld flavors. Taste and adjust seasoning (add a pinch of salt or a squeeze of lime if desired).

8

Garnish

Remove from heat and sprinkle with toasted sesame seeds and sliced green onion greens. Add chopped cilantro if using.

To Serve

9

Divide warm rice among bowls (about 3/4 cup rice per serving). Top each bowl with a portion of the fire chicken and vegetables. Add optional pickles/kimchi to the side for contrast and a lime wedge. Serve immediately.
